								Team SA Olympian Rebecca Meder returned to the podium at the second stop of the World Aquatics Swimming World Cup series in Westmont, Illinois over the weekend. The 23-year-old added to her haul of two bronze medals from the first stop a week earlier with another bronze in the 200m breaststroke. Meder stopped the clock…
